- Please provide the solution to this financial accounting question with accurate financial calculations.Estimate the weighted-average cost of capital for Home Depot (HD), Altria (MO), Caterpillar (CAT), and Intel (INTC). You can estimate the expected stock returns for these companies by using the betas shown on finance.yahoo.com. You can also use Yahoo! Finance to find the relative proportions of equity and debt for each company. Remember, though, to use the mar- ket value of the equity, not its book value. Finding the yield on the debt is a little trickier. One possibility it to log on to the Federal Reserve Bank of St. Louis site at https://fred.stlouisfed .org/ to find the current level of Treasury yields and the yield spreads (i.e., the extra yield for bonds with different ratings). An alternative is to view recent transactions at www.finra.org /industry/trace/corporate-bond-data.
